What is a Drone Wiring Harness?
A drone wiring harness is essentially a group of wires that connects various components of the drone, such as the flight controller, motors, sensors, and battery. Think of it as the nervous system of the drone, facilitating communication between different parts. These harnesses are meticulously designed to ensure durability, reliability, and minimal weight—key factors that are vital for flight performance.
Design and Functionality
The design of drone wiring harnesses often focuses on minimizing interference and optimizing space within the drone's frame. Manufacturers usually use high-quality materials resistant to wear and tear, as drones are often exposed to diverse weather conditions and environments.
In addition, drone wiring harnesses can be custom-made to match the specific configuration and needs of the UAV. This customization ensures that the connections are not only compatible but also efficient in delivering power and signals throughout the vehicle.
What are UAV Cable Solutions?
UAV cable solutions encompass a wider range of products and components beyond just wiring harnesses. These solutions include various types of cables designed for specific functions within the UAV system. From high-flex cables suited for camera gimbals to robust power cables that supply energy to heavy-duty motors, UAV cable solutions offer the versatility required for modern drone applications.
Types of Cables
UAV cable solutions can include:

- Power Cables: These are designed to transfer electricity from the battery to the motors and other components.
- Signal Cables: Essential for communication between the flight controller and various sensors, these cables must be lightweight and capable of handling data transmission without loss.
- Specialized Cables: Certain UAVs may require cables that can withstand extreme temperatures or high flexing; solutions are available based on specific use cases.
Key Differences Between Wiring Harnesses and Cable Solutions
Understanding the differences between drone wiring harnesses and UAV cable solutions can help you optimize your drone system effectively. Here are some key distinctions:
1. Scope and Functionality
While a wiring harness primarily focuses on connecting components within the drone, UAV cable solutions encompass a broader range of cables designed for multiple functions. Essentially, all wiring harnesses are cable solutions, but not all cable solutions qualify as wiring harnesses.
2. Customization
Drone wiring harnesses tend to be customized to fit a specific drone configuration, whereas UAV cable solutions can often be purchased off-the-shelf for general applications. However, specialized cable configurations can be created based on unique project requirements.
3. Installation Process
Wiring harnesses usually require a more intricate installation process due to their tailored design. Proper installation is vital to prevent damage and ensure efficient communication between components. On the other hand, UAV cable solutions are often more straightforward to install since they can be easily linked to existing ports or connectors.
